Instructions
Wash/Rinse the Poha with water and rub it with your fingers.Drain the water and keep the poha in the aside for a few minutes.
Meanwhile,heat oil in a wok.
Add the mustard seeds, red mustard seeds(rai) .Let them splutter.
Now add the onions and cook them until golden brown.
Now, add the carrots, capsicum and green peas.
Sprinkle a little water over it and simmer the flame. Cover and cook for 5 minutes or till the veggies are a bit tender.
Open, mix well and add the salt, chili powder, turmeric and mix well.Cook for 2 minutes.
Add the poha and mix well along with the curry leaves. Break the curry leaves with your fingers to release their aroma .
Mix well and then cover this for 2 minutes on simmer.
Shut down the flame. Add coriander leaves, lemon juice ,peanuts and coconut powder and mix well.
Garnish with coriander leaves and coconut powder and serve hot.
